Carrick’s classy gesture during Man United U21s’ win over Sporting – something Amorim never did
Manchester United U21s claimed a 3-2 win over Sporting CP in the Premier League International Cup at Progress With Unity Stadium on Tuesday evening.
Interim head coach Michael Carrick was in attendance, in contrast to former manager Ruben Amorim, who did not attend any of Travis Binnion’s matches during his time at the club.
Gabriel Biancheri, who netted a brace in the 2-0 win over Borussia Dortmund in December was named in the starting line-up, but it was James Scanlon who stole the show.
